nur-packages

My NUR packages
git clone git://git.sikmir.ru/nur-packages
Log | Files | Refs | README | LICENSE

commit a57bf5abeab810736e772fd66e71246ade66e896
parent ed59451d3a656d07191d7b836ac63322ad2aa80d
Author: Nikolay Korotkiy <sikmir@disroot.org>
Date:   Sat, 30 Aug 2025 12:03:14 +0400

Add rodnik

Diffstat:
Mpkgs/default.nix | 1+
Apkgs/misc/rodnik/default.nix | 27+++++++++++++++++++++++++++
2 files changed, 28 insertions(+), 0 deletions(-)

diff --git a/pkgs/default.nix b/pkgs/default.nix @@ -399,6 +399,7 @@ lib.makeScope newScope ( repolocli = callPackage ./misc/repolocli { }; rhttp = callPackage ./misc/rhttp { }; riffraff = callPackage ./misc/riffraff { }; + rodnik = callPackage ./misc/rodnik { }; rst2txt = callPackage ./misc/rst2txt { }; sdorfehs = callPackage ./misc/sdorfehs { }; serverpp = callPackage ./misc/serverpp { }; diff --git a/pkgs/misc/rodnik/default.nix b/pkgs/misc/rodnik/default.nix @@ -0,0 +1,27 @@ +{ + lib, + fetchFromGitHub, + php, +}: + +php.buildComposerProject2 (finalAttrs: { + pname = "rodnik"; + version = "2025.08.26"; + + src = fetchFromGitHub { + owner = "dwcoaching"; + repo = "rodnik"; + rev = "07713413efe57a5cbffff21100e2597fcbf2467c"; + hash = "sha256-sxGC18GrgIm9/a0ZEtJIc8JTTRjnieuE40EiCqNoqKs="; + }; + + vendorHash = "sha256-zOFjjOYVcUuQfkqIMmbP+R+QlvjRB/8oIWeXgLoWlfw="; + + meta = { + description = "Rodnik.today"; + homepage = "https://github.com/dwcoaching/rodnik"; + license = lib.licenses.free; + maintainers = [ lib.maintainers.sikmir ]; + skip.ci = true; + }; +})